Output 8981c6002bcacaef56a23fd3d1a54f1c19caaf39e10f13fee0b6a2d3afc769a3:17

value
630268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0035fd150d02dd0e3bd8898b1b217c2e13b1c083 OP_EQUALVERIFY OP_CHECKSIG
address
1127gCF9kz6hr4cv7vX4JpWW85hndxDWyC
transaction
8981c6002bcacaef56a23fd3d1a54f1c19caaf39e10f13fee0b6a2d3afc769a3
spent
true